Take hold of a monster opportunity and join our Commercial Platforms team as a Senior Full Stack Developer - Beam.If you’re a good fit for this role and live in Brisbane, Sydney or Melbourne, we’d love you to apply. Why join us? You'll get 14% super as standard, to help your future come alive. Unleash your potential and build a career to be proud of through excellent training and development opportunities. Balance your work between in-person days at our purpose-built hubs and working from home. In the office, enjoy end of trip facilities, a yoga and multi-faith room, parent and carer rooms, quiet rooms, BrewHub coffee facilities, and collaborative team spaces. About the role We’re all about helping our members make the most of their money. And while they go after their goals, you can too. As a Senior Full Stack Developer - Beam , you'll play a key role in the success of our B2B and software partner digital product suite, supporting the product vision and objectives through the adoption of industry leading tools, technologies, practices and methods by the development team. You will be responsible for the design and delivery of software solutions to meet business needs and will be required to analyse, design and develop elegant solutions that can be delivered to market quickly and with a high level of quality. You will work in a team of developers, and in partnerships with other teams, designers and UX specialists to deliver end to end digital projects from strategy to implementation. Day to day, you'll: Collaborate with product stakeholders to translate design concepts into functional code. Build and release software, ensuring successful deployment to Test and Production environments. Integrate with backend services and APIs to fetch and display data. Conduct adequate unit and system testing, providing expert advice to the test team, ensuring all software components and systems are tested effectively. Provide technical support, including out of hours, ensuring client issues are resolved in a timely manner. Perform code and design reviews of software developed by others in accordance with company standards, ensuring consistent high-quality solutions are developed. Prepare systems documentation, ensuring all systems have adequate documentation to facilitate future maintenance in the absence of the original designers and/or developers. Communicate progress and issues to management and other stakeholders. This role is a permanent opportunity. About you It goes without saying you'll be a great communicator with top notch interpersonal skills. We'll also expect you to pick up problems and come up with quick, creative ways to solve them. It's quite likely you tick some of the following boxes too: Strong experience in application programming and design. Experience in Server-side Programming Languages (eg, Java, C#) and frameworks (e.g. Springboot, .Net). Hands on experience in Frontend Development preferably using React Typescript. Exposure to Rest APIs, microservices architecture and containerisation: Docker, Kubernetes. Experience and Understanding of Cloud Services. Solid understanding of Clean Code, TDD and BDD development practices. Strong experience in CI/CD pipeline build, maintenance and automation. Demonstrated experience using OOP techniques, including class modelling and appropriate implementation of design patterns. Demonstrated experience of the SDLC, including requirements clarification, data analysis. About us Our 2.4 million members trust us to take care of over $330 billion in retirement savings. And we help them take charge of their finances and face the future with confidence. Our inclusive culture means you’ll be valued and heard in a respectful workplace. We've created an environment where you can be yourself and do amazing work. It's that simple. Apply online now Everyone is welcome to apply. We value diverse thinking, cultures, perspectives, backgrounds, and abilities. Awaken your career at Australian Retirement Trust and apply now. Applications close Friday, 28 November 2025. We don’t want to leave you with a monstrous wait. So, you’ll hear from us after the closing date to find out whether you’ve made it through to the next round or not. Being fair and up-front is important to us – and recruitment is no different.